Ramón Urías is a professional infielder for the Baltimore Orioles, originally from Magdalena de Kino, Mexico. In 2010, Urías signed with the Texas Rangers organization as an international free agent. He played for the Diablos Rojos del Mexico under the Mexican League, and later signed with the St. Louis Cardinals. After growing within the organization and improving his game, Ramón was added to the Cardinals’ 40-man roster and traded to the Baltimore Orioles where he made his first major league start in 2020.
Throughout the 2022 season, Ramón was the Orioles starting third baseman, asserting himself as a key figure in the team’s success. His excellence at bat and incredible record at base earned Ramón the American League Gold Glove Award for third baseman. Off the field, Ramón enjoys traveling and spending time with his family, and fiancée, Andrea. Ramón is one half of a successful MLB brother duo, with his older brother, Luis, playing as a Red Sox infielder.
